What is a Cyber Red Team job?

A Cyber Red Team job involves simulating real-world cyberattacks to test an organization's security defenses. Red teamers use adversarial t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s) to identify vulnerabilities in networks, systems, and applications. Their goal is to improve security by exposing weaknesses before real attackers can exploit them. They work closely with blue teams (defensive security) to enhance an organization's overall cyber resilience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Cyber Red Team position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Cyber Red Team professional, you need strong expertise in ethical hacking, penetration testing, vulnerability assessment, and a thorough understanding of cyber defense strategies, typically supported by a degree in cybersecurity or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Metasploit, Burp Suite, and Kali Linux, as well as industry certifications such as OSCP or CEH, is highly valued. Excellent probl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and the ability to communicate complex findings clearly with both technical and non-technical stakeholders set candidates apart. These capabilities are essential for simulating real-world attacks, identifying security gaps, and helping organizations strengthen their cyber defenses.

What does a typical workday look like for a Cyber Red Team member?

A typical day for a Cyber Red Team member involves designing and executing simulated cyber attacks to assess an organization’s security posture. This includes planning engagements, conducting penetration tests, documenting vulnerabilities, and reporting findings in a clear and actionable manner. Collaboration with Blue Teams (defenders), IT, and security leadership is common to ensure vulnerabilities are understood and mitigated. The role is dynamic, often involving both independent research and teamwork in a fast-paced, evolving environment, providing continuous learning and professional growth opportunities.
